Wellness-Infused Coffee Innovations
Adaptogenic and Functional Blends
The integration of adaptogens and nootropics into morning coffee routines represents a significant paradigm shift toward functional beverage consumption. Mushroom-infused coffee blends featuring cordyceps, lion's mane, and chaga have emerged as prominent players in the wellness-focused coffee market. These mycological additions purport to enhance cognitive function while mitigating coffee's traditional jittery effects.
Adaptogens like ashwagandha, rhodiola, and holy basil are being seamlessly incorporated into premium coffee formulations. These botanical compounds allegedly support adrenal function and stress resilience, making them particularly appealing to modern professionals seeking balanced energy throughout demanding workdays. The synergistic relationship between caffeine and these ancient remedies creates a more sustained, harmonious energy profile.

Personalized Nutrition Integration
The convergence of personalized nutrition and coffee consumption has birthed bespoke morning rituals tailored to individual metabolic profiles. Genetic testing and biomarker analysis now inform coffee selection, with specific varietals and processing methods chosen to complement personal caffeine metabolism rates. This scientific approach eliminates guesswork while optimizing physiological benefits.
Collagen peptides, MCT oil, and plant-based protein powders are becoming standard additions to morning coffee preparations. These supplements transform the traditional cup into a complete nutritional foundation, supporting everything from joint health to ketogenic lifestyle maintenance. The resulting beverage becomes a multifaceted wellness tool rather than simple stimulation.

Carbon-Neutral and Zero-Waste Initiatives
The coffee industry's environmental impact has catalyzed innovative approaches to carbon neutrality and waste reduction. Roasters are implementing renewable energy systems, optimizing transportation logistics, and developing compostable packaging solutions. These initiatives resonate deeply with environmentally conscious consumers who view their morning ritual as an extension of their values.
Circular economy principles are being applied to coffee production, with spent grounds repurposed for everything from soil amendments to skincare products. This comprehensive approach to resource utilization minimizes waste while creating additional value streams for coffee businesses.
Artisanal Brewing Methodologies
Precision Temperature and Timing Control
The pursuit of brewing perfection has led to unprecedented precision in temperature and extraction timing. Smart brewing devices equipped with PID controllers maintain water temperature within one-degree accuracy, while programmable timers ensure consistent extraction profiles. This technological advancement democratizes barista-level brewing expertise for home practitioners.
Innovative brewing methods like the AeroPress inverted technique, Chemex immersion variations, and Japanese iced coffee preparations have gained mainstream adoption. Each methodology offers distinct flavor profiles and extraction characteristics, allowing enthusiasts to customize their morning experience based on mood and preference.
Single-Origin Exploration and Terroir Appreciation
The wine industry's concept of terroir has found profound expression in specialty coffee culture. Single-origin enthusiasts now explore coffee's geographical fingerprints with the same intensity as sommelier-level wine appreciation. Elevation, soil composition, processing methods, and microclimatic conditions all contribute to distinctive flavor signatures that educated palates can identify and appreciate.
Seasonal coffee offerings mirror agricultural rhythms, with harvest calendars determining availability and freshness. This temporal awareness adds anticipation and appreciation to the morning ritual, as consumers eagerly await specific regional harvests throughout the year.
| Origin Region | Flavor Profile | Best Brewing Method | Harvest Season |
|---|---|---|---|
| Colombian Huila | Chocolate, Caramel, Orange | Pour-over | October-February |
| Ethiopian Yirgacheffe | Floral, Tea-like, Citrus | Light roast espresso | November-February |
| Jamaican Blue Mountain | Mild, Sweet, Balanced | French press | September-March |

Cultural Fusion and Global Influences
International coffee traditions are increasingly influencing Western morning rituals, creating fascinating cultural hybridizations. Turkish coffee's ceremonial aspects, Ethiopian coffee ceremony mindfulness, and Cuban cafecito social elements are being adapted for modern contexts. These cross-cultural exchanges enrich the morning coffee experience while honoring traditional practices.
The appreciation for different roasting styles—from Scandinavian light roasts highlighting origin characteristics to Italian dark roasts emphasizing caramelization—provides variety and education within established morning routines. This global perspective transforms daily coffee consumption into a world exploration journey.
